Approvals — Restockly planner. Any change to the demand-forecast weights or machine route ordering requires one approval from the planning pod and a dry-run against the Copperfield depot dataset. Config-only tweaks may ship with a single reviewer. Emergency restock overrides must be logged in the sync notes. Final sign-off authority for all releases belongs to the person named below.

named custodian: Brivan Eliath Quenox Frador

Facilities ticket — Halewick Tower, night shift.

Issue: support team reporting east stairwell reader rejecting badges after midnight. Reader was reset this morning; firmware updated. Overnight crew should now badge as normal. If the reader fails again, use the manual keypad by the fire door — do not prop the door. Log any further failures with the time and badge name. Temporary keypad code for the fallback door is below.

door code, tajeg-fawip: bdg-K-62

Webhook delivery in Cartbell's notifier service retries failed posts with exponential backoff plus jitter. Each endpoint gets an independent retry budget, so one slow consumer can't starve the queue. Capacity-wise, plan for roughly triple the steady-state rate during a downstream outage, since retries pile up until the dead-letter cutoff. Workers scale on queue depth, not CPU. The defaults are conservative; raise them only with a ticket. The current tuning constants are listed here.

tuning constants:
QUOTAS = {
    "druwyn": 5,
    "holix": 5,
    "zorath": 5,
    "holwyn": 10,
}

### TKT-917: Signature verification failure on stock-recon nightly

The Stockmarsh inventory reconciliation job failed at the artifact verification step last night. The bundle was built from the feature branch, which still embeds the retired fingerprint in its verify config. Fix is a one-line update in the pipeline manifest; please review the attached diff. The config should reference the current key, included below.

deploy key for kajof-fajop: bky6_gDHw9Q